How Common Is The Last Name Le-Moignan? popularity and diffusion

Le-Moignan is the 3,882,373rd most commonly occurring surname globally. It is borne by around 1 in 280,290,228 people. The surname is predominantly found in Europe, where 100 percent of Le-Moignan live; 100 percent live in Northern Europe and 100 percent live in British Isles.

The last name Le-Moignan is most commonly occurring in England, where it is carried by 13 people, or 1 in 4,286,005. In England Le-Moignan is mostly found in: Durham, where 46 percent are found, Staffordshire, where 31 percent are found and Hampshire, where 23 percent are found. Aside from England this surname is found in 2 countries. It is also found in The Isle of Man, where 38 percent are found and Northern Ireland, where 12 percent are found.
